Galway United 0-0 Longford Town  

Galway United and Longford Town played out an uneventful 0-0 draw in the SSE Airtricity League Premier Division at Eamonn Deacy Park.

The main topic of discussion at the Corribside venue was the news that Galway are set to announce their new manager early next week.

Tommy Dunne was sacked on 30 September and an appointment is imminent in the West after this draw with Longford.

Though Galway bossed vast chunks of the first half, they squandered a couple of chances and Longford, already relegated, held out to secure a point.

Galway went close in the seventh minute when a lengthy Conor Winn clearance spilled kindly for Gary Shanahan, but his firm right-footed shot was saved by Paul Skinner.

In the 11th minute Armin Aganovic, Conor Melody, and Shanahan were all involved in a clever build-up, but a Kevin Devaney effort was deflected out for a corner.

Devaney’s delivery from that set-piece was headed wide by Stephen Folan as Galway pushed for an opener.

The Tribesmen survived a significant scare in the 22nd minute when a Kevin O’Connor cross was controlled by David O’Sullivan, but the attacker was thwarted by a Winn save.

Devaney was denied again in the 36th minute by a fine reflex stop from Skinner as Galway continued to probe.

When the interval rolled around the teams were still deadlocked, with Longford content to have frustrated the locals.

A dreadful third quarter, high on perspiration but low on inspiration followed, with little goalmouth action as both teams struggled.

Longford spurned a gilt-edged opportunity when failing to punish sloppy play from Galway in the 69th minute as O’Sullivan dragged an attempt wide.
